## Why Keep the TestAppServer builder API change reviewable by moving the repository-wide caller migration into a mechanical follow-up. ## What - replace TestAppServer constructor callsites with equivalent builder chains - preserve each caller's automatic-environment, args, program, env, managed-config, plugin-startup, and JSON-logging behavior - make no TestAppServer implementation changes ## Validation - cargo check -p codex-app-server --tests ## Cleanup stack 1.
